gioarmani Posted December 15, 2006 Author Report Posted December 15, 2006 One last question, if you look at the dial print on this, it's all white. Tonight I went to a different AD, and they had A Sea Pro similar to this, but the Omega symbol was a piece of steel glued to the dial, not painted like it is here, and the word "Seamaster" was in red ink & not white. The only other major difference was the case-back had a much more prominent & larger etching, like the PO. Has anyone seen this model before, or is this the latest generation of gen?
